    Cardinals rally for Kevin Ware...
    :cool:
    Louisville's Ware breaks leg in tourney game
    Mar. 31`13 — A gruesome injury that left Louisville guard Kevin Ware with a broken leg plunged Lucas Oil Stadium into horrified silence, with coach Rick Pitino wiping away tears and shocked teammates openly weeping during Sunday's Midwest Regional final.
    See also:

    CBS halts replays of basketball player's injury
    Mar. 31`13 — CBS is telling its NCAA basketball crew not to show replays of Louisville guard Kevin Ware's gruesome injury during Sunday's tournament game between his team and Duke.
    And...

    Louisville beats Duke 85-63 to reach Final Four
    Mar. 31,`13 — With tears in their eyes and Kevin Ware in their hearts, there was no way Louisville was losing this game.

    what a year for cardinal athletics

    Football: sugar bowl win over #3 Florida marking the biggest upset in BCS history
    Mens basketball: Big east and regional champs for the 2nd year in a row final 4 for second year in a row
    Woman's basketball: biggest upset in woman's basketball history with a win over baylor

    Possible national championships on the horizon
